Abstract :

Bedside ultrasound evaluation is a simple diagnostic method for infections and can be performed by clinicians promptly at the bedside, using simple equipment and without irradiation. The discovery of the foci using ultrasound often enables prompt antimicrobial therapy and even early ultrasound-guided procedure, facilitating earlier microbiology confirmation. These procedures are made safer using ultrasound by the clinician. Future challenges for an infectious diseases specialist include training and gaining experience about the appropriate use of point-of-care ultrasound (POCUS).
